Has anyone ever seen an error like this before?

I came it to work this morning and my Users couldn't access there email and
I couldn't access my 550 via SSH or HTTP. 

I changed the IP address through the LCD from .51 to .52 then I could access
the server fine. The Virtual sites and email are still serving from the old
IP address .51 . I have 3 virtual sites that are served from .51 and the
hardware had also used that address without incident for about 18 months
until this morning.  Note I hadn't applied the EOL Patch when this error
occurred.

 

I am up and running now but this error has baffled me as to what caused it.
